> when PharoDebug.log can't be created (e.g., when the image is in a non
> writeable directory like /usr/share), the errors are sent to the
> Transcript in the hope that they will be redirected to stdout or
> stderr. However, ContextPart>>errorReportOn: is called when an
> exception is signaled and this method assumes that the stream is
> positionable (which is not the case for transscript, stdin and
> stderr). I was planing on rewriting ContextPart>>errorReportOn: to
> make it independent of #position. What do you think?

Please do, I can't imagine why it needs to do positioning just to write output, 
you know that I think the stream API is way to wide...
